HSBC Interview Guide 2026

HSBC is a Middle Market investment bank founded in 1865 and headquartered in London, UK. The interview process consists of a first round and a Superday with no HireVue, with analyst classes of 150-200 and an acceptance rate near 5-7%. One of the world's largest banking organizations, it has a dominant presence in Asia-Pacific and EMEA and is particularly well-regarded for Asia-linked M&A and capital markets across TMT, healthcare, industrials, FIG, natural resources, and real estate.

HSBC is best known for Cross-Border M&A, Capital Markets, Project Finance, Asia-Linked Deals work, with leading industry coverage in TMT, Healthcare, Industrials, FIG. Candidates often compare HSBC to peer firms covered on this site.

HSBC's interview process tests technical competency alongside global awareness. Expect questions about international markets, cross-border M&A, and emerging market dynamics. The firm values candidates who demonstrate genuine interest in global finance.

Superday Format

Typically 3-5 interviews covering technicals, behavioral questions, and market awareness. Strong emphasis on global markets knowledge and cross-border transaction understanding.

HSBC has a global, diverse culture with a strong emphasis on international mobility. Hours are demanding but generally considered more manageable than top US bulge brackets. The firm's strength in Asia provides unique cross-border deal exposure. Exit opportunities are solid, particularly for roles with an international or Asia focus.
